find f(-2) for the function f(x)=x^2-6

you would subitute -2 for x in the equation
f(-2)=x^2-6
PEMDAS so exonents
-2^2-6
negative times a negative= positive
4-6
f(-2)=-2


f(x) means that you subsitute x for x in the equation  exg
f(1)=x+2 means f(1)=1+2
f(4)=x+2 means f(4)=4+2
